    Creative Entryway Ideas For Making A Stunning First Impression

    In every well-designed home, the entryway plays a great role in establishing the ambience that makes guests feel welcome from the moment they step inside. You might wonder, “How can I create an inviting entryway?”

    Regardless of the dimensions of your entry space, whether it’s a spacious foyer or a compact nook, there are several straightforward entryway ideas and concepts to enhance the overall appeal of your residence.

    Focus on Curb Appeal

    Before guests even step inside, the exterior of your home makes an impression. Make sure the entry and front yard are neat, clean, and well-maintained. Freshly swept walkways, trimmed bushes and plants, and a tidy yard help convey that guests are entering a space that is cared for. Painting the front door in a cheerful, contrasting colour will tell a story while drawing attention and sparking wonder. Add stylish exterior lighting to brighten up the entry at night.

    Incorporate Storage

    The entryway tends to collect clutter like shoes, coats, bags, and assorted items. Make sure your entryway is equipped with plenty of storage to neatly tuck away these items. Attractive cabinets and cubbies are great for hiding shoes. Coat hooks on the wall or a coat rack provide spots to hang outerwear. Console tables with drawers can hold anything from gloves and boots to the dog leash and anything else you want to keep handy near the front door.

    Place a Rug

    An area rug brings warmth while also defining the entry space. Opt for a low-pile floor rug that is durable and easy to clean, as entry rugs tend to see a lot of foot traffic. Place the front legs of console tables or benches on the rug to add texture and colours to other areas of your home. Make sure the rug is large enough to comfortably stand on while removing shoes.

    Provide Seating

    Having a designated spot for seating serves as a convenience for the moments when you need to remove your shoes or wait for others to get ready. Introducing a bench, ottoman, or even an armchair proves to be a practical solution for offering a comfortable place to sit. The best entryway seating options also provide ample space for setting down bags, coats, or shoes and effectively keeping items off the floor to maintain a tidy and organised space.

    Add Lighting

    Some entryways are dark and uninviting, but you can change them up with small fixes. Install overhead lighting to make your entry lighter and brighter. For extra cosiness, include lamps on console tables or side tables. Use dimmers to adjust lighting levels as needed.

    Include Mirrors

    Thoughtfully positioned mirrors can work wonders in creating the illusion of a more spacious and open atmosphere in a compact entryway. A mirror near the door allows a final outfit check before heading out. One above a console table reflects and amplifies overhead lighting. Frame mirrors can add an extra layer of style and sophistication to your entry space.

    Add Decorative Touches

    Carefully chosen accents and accessories have the power to infuse your entryway with a personal touch of style. Fresh floral arrangements on console tables brighten up the space. Wall art, whether a large statement piece or a collage of framed prints, adds visual interest. Cubbies or shelving units adorned with decorative objects seamlessly become part of the overall display while adding a functional dimension to the design. Use baskets to hold useful items like gloves or sunglasses. The inclusion of candles, greenery, and distinctive decor immediately enhances the entryway ambience.

    Keep It Clutter-Free

    No matter how beautiful the entryway is, clutter ruins the effect and gives off a sense of disorganisation. Make sure everything has a designated storage spot to create a tidy, clutter-free entryway. A key practise is promptly returning shoes, bags, and other items to their designated spots. Maintain the surfaces of your console tables with minimal decor, preventing them from becoming magnets for clutter.

    In a Nutshell

    The entry sets expectations for the rest of the house. By incorporating storage, seating, lighting, and decor, you can design an entryway that makes guests feel comfortable and welcome from the moment they arrive. Keep these tips in mind for a warm, inviting space that wows as soon as the front door opens.
